This presentation explores the musical recordings Louis Armstrong made as leader between 1925 and 1928 while living in Chicago. 

This interactive presentation includes Canva slides and other projected media to help contextualize this foundational period in the development of jazz. 

John plays actual period instruments during the presentation allowing the audience to gain further understanding of the special nuances relating to Armstrong’s performance.
